Sustainable Construction

"Sustainable Construction" a project in Central America, specifically Guatemala, launched in 2022 within the private sector. This project promotes the path to sustainability through a Sustainability Roadmap designed for a construction materials factory that uses waste as a primary resource. By addressing changing operational environments, commitments, ESG (Environmental, Social, Governance), SDGs (Sustainable Development Goals), and CSR (Corporate Social Responsibility), "Sustainable Construction" aims to mitigate risks, go beyond regulations, and enhance stakeholder value. By prioritizing sustainability approaches, resilience, and differentiation of services, "Sustainable Construction" contributes to competitiveness, growth, and recognition within the construction materials sector while promoting a resilient and sustainable business model.
